Business Consulting: The Key to Unlocking Your Company’s Potential

Business consulting can mean different things to different businesses. Many times, business consultants are brought in to provide an objective view of the company operations and offer recommendations for improvement. However, business consulting can also include short-term projects such as developing a new marketing campaign or designing a customer loyalty program. In other words, business consulting is a flexible service that can be tailored to the specific needs of any business.

Healthcare

There’s no doubt that the healthcare sector is undergoing some major changes. With the rise of new technologies and the ever-changing landscape of insurance and regulations, it can be tough to keep up. That’s where business consulting comes in. By bringing in an outside perspective, businesses can get the insights and guidance they need to make strategic decisions for the future.

Healthcare is a complex industry, but with the help of a business consultant, you can navigate the challenges and come out ahead. Here are just a few ways that business consulting can be beneficial for the healthcare sector:

  • Improve efficiency and reduce costs: One of the biggest challenges facing healthcare organizations is finding ways to improve efficiency and cut costs. Business consultants can help by identifying areas of waste and developing strategies to streamline processes. This can lead to significant cost savings for healthcare organizations, which can ultimately be passed on to patients in the form of lower fees.
  • Keep up with changing regulations: Another big challenge facing healthcare organizations is keeping up with constantly changing regulations. Business consultants can help by staying up to date on all the latest changes and developments in healthcare regulation. This way, you can be sure that your organization is compliant with all the latest rules and guidelines.
  • Improve patient care: Ultimately, the goal of any healthcare organization is to provide quality, value-based care to patients. Business consultants can help by identifying areas where patient care can be improved. This might involve anything from streamlining appointment scheduling to developing new methods for training staff. By making improvements in patient care, you can not only improve satisfaction levels but also reduce costs associated with re-admissions and readmissions
  • Enhance communication: Communication is essential in any organization, but it’s especially important in healthcare due to the complex nature of the medical treatment. Business consultants can help by developing clear and effective communication channels between patients, doctors, nurses, and support staff. This way, everyone will be on the same page and working together towards a common goal: providing quality care to patients.

Restaurants and Food Service

Many restaurants and food service businesses operate on tight margins, so it’s essential to make the most of every opportunity.

Business consulting can help in this regard by providing expert advice on a variety of topics, from marketing and accounting to operations and human resources. Besides that, they can also help identify areas where restaurants and food service businesses can save money. For example, a consultant might recommend changes to the way inventory is managed or suggest ways to streamline the ordering process.

By taking advantage of business consulting services, restaurants and food service businesses can improve their bottom line and better position themselves for success.
